What Is Shingrix Vaccine?

Shingrix Vaccine is an FDA-approved vaccine designed to prevent shingles (herpes zoster), a painful rash caused by the reactivation of the varicella zoster virus. It is administered as a 2-dose series, typically 2 to 6 months apart. Shingrix provides over 90% effectiveness in preventing shingles in adults aged 50 and above, and offers long-lasting protection. By strengthening the immune system, it reduces the likelihood of developing shingles and helps maintain quality of life, especially in older adults.

How It Works

Shingrix Vaccine is a non-live recombinant vaccine that uses a protein component of the varicella zoster virus, combined with an adjuvant (AS01B) to boost the body’s immune response. It is given via intramuscular injection, usually in the upper arm. The immune system is activated to recognize and fight the virus if it reactivates later in life. Completing both doses is essential for optimal protection.

FAQ

Q1: Is Shingrix Vaccine good for life?
A1: No, protection lasts about 7 to 10 years. A booster may be needed in the future depending on your condition.

Q2: How often should I get Shingrix Vaccine?
A2: Two doses total, 2 to 6 months apart. No routine booster needed for now.

Q3: Are there long-term side effects from Shingrix Vaccine?
A3: Long-term side effects are rare. Most people only experience short-term reactions like arm pain or fatigue.

Q4: Does Shingrix Vaccine prevent dementia?
A4: No, it is not proven to prevent dementia, though it may reduce some related risks.

Q5: Can Shingrix Vaccine cause memory loss?
A5: No. There is no evidence linking Shingrix Vaccine to memory loss.
